Species
Forstera tenella
Etymology
Forstera: Named after Johann Reinhold Forster and his son Johann Georg Adam Forster who were 18th century naturalists on James Cook's second voyage
tenella: delicate

Life Cycle and Dispersal
Winged seeds are dispersed by wind (Thorsen et al., 2009).
